1God is our refuge and strength, a very present help in trouble. 2Therefore we will not fear when the earth changes, when mountains are slipping into the midst of the seas. 3Let its waters roar and foam; let the mountains shake with the swelling of it. Selah. 4There is a river whose streams cause rejoicing in the city of God, the consecrated place of the tabernacle of the Most High. 5God is in the midst of her; she shall not be moved; God shall help her at the break of day. 6The nations raged, the kingdoms were shaken; He uttered His voice, the earth melted. 7Jehovah of Hosts is with us; the God of Jacob is our refuge. Selah. 8Come, behold the works of Jehovah, who has made desolations on the earth; 9who makes wars to cease to the ends of the earth; He breaks the bow and cuts the spear in two; He burns the chariots in the fire. 10Be still, and know that I am God! I will be exalted among the nations, I will be exalted in the earth! 11Jehovah of Hosts is with us; the God of Jacob is our refuge. Selah.
